This course is designed to equip NGO professionals with practical, proven techniques to secure funding and build long-term financial sustainability. It explores the full spectrum of resource mobilization — from grant writing and donor engagement to income-generating activities and partnerships. Participants will learn to align fundraising strategies with their mission, diversify income streams, and meet evolving donor expectations.
